All plants which are Perennial Flowers, basically have different names in different languages. As these names vary from region to region, scientists came up with one single name for all plants, which are called scientific names. Scientific Name of Lavatera and French Lavender is used by scientists worldwide. Scientific names are name used by scientists, especially the taxonomic name of an organisms that consist of the genus and species. Lavatera and French Lavender in Spanish is also different. Lavatera in Spanish is known as malva and French Lavender in Spanish is known as lavanda francés.
